RIZAL, Palawan - The Philippines-Australia (PH-Aus) Exercise Alon 2023 conducted an Air Assault Exercise at Punta Baja in Rizal, Palawan on August 21, 2023.
This marked the first major training serial as part of the bilateral cooperation between the Armed Forces of the Philippines (AFP) and the Australian Defence Force (ADF) as part of the latter’s Indo-Pacific Endeavour (IPE) activities for 2023.
CAMP AGUINALDO, Quezon City—The annual humanitarian assistance and disaster relief (HADR) exercise, Pacific Partnership, returns to the country, in San Fernando, La Union.
Now on its 18th iteration, Pacific Partnership 2023 (PP23) is the US’ largest annual multinational HADR exercise aimed at enhancing preparedness and interoperability with seven host partner nations in the Indo-Pacific.
From 22-31 August, PP23 will feature HADR; medical, dental, and veterinary; and engineering activities.

Over 100 paratroopers from the Philippine Air Force, Philippine Army, and United States Air Force joined the military free fall mission on August 16, 2023.
The free fallers and airborne qualified soldiers jumped at an altitude of 6000 ft and 1500 ft. and successfully maneuvered towards the target area in Brgy Liwayway, Sta Rosa, Nueva Ecija.
